Development and Purpose
The MIM-104 Patriot, a renowned surface-to-air missile system, has gone through significant development to serve a crucial purpose in modern warfare scenarios. Understanding the development and purpose of this advanced weapon system is essential for comprehending its operational significance. Here’s a breakdown:
-
Development: The MIM-104 Patriot system was initially developed by Raytheon in the 1960s to counter airborne threats effectively. Over the years, it has undergone multiple upgrades and enhancements, incorporating cutting-edge technologies to adapt to evolving enemy tactics and capabilities.
-
Purpose: The primary purpose of the MIM-104 Patriot is to provide air defense against enemy threats, including aircraft, drones, and ballistic missiles. With its advanced radar systems and intercept capabilities, the Patriot system aims to detect, track, and neutralize incoming threats to safeguard critical assets and personnel on the ground.

Case Studies: Successful Enemy Countermeasures
Case studies play a pivotal role in understanding the real-world application and success of enemy countermeasures. Let’s delve into some instances where successful enemy countermeasures were implemented effectively:
- In the Gulf War of 1991, the MIM-104 Patriot system demonstrated its prowess in intercepting and neutralizing incoming Scud missiles, notably in the defense of Saudi Arabia and Israel.
